PARAQUAT INCREASES SUPEROXIDE-DISMUTASE ACTIVITY AND RADIATION-RESISTANCE IN 2 MOUSE LYMPHOMA L5178Y CELL STRAINS OF DIFFERENT RADIOSENSITIVITIES

摘要
It is shown that paraquat treatment (1 h, 1 x 10(-5) mol/l) increases the activity of superoxide dismutase (SOD) in L5178Y (LY) R and S cells by about three times. When combined with X-irradiation, 0.5 h of treatment preceding irradiation increased the SOD activity two-fold and the alpha/beta-ratio three-fold, as estimated from the X-ray survival curves. LY-S cells were more sensitivite than LY-R cells to treatment with paraquat alone. These results indicate that SOD may be a radioprotective enzyme in LY strains and that LY-S cells are particularly sensitive to superoxide radicals as a result of a relatively low SOD activity. This explains their sensitivity to paraquat, which generates O2-, and to X-rays. The low SOD level may also explain the higher initial DNA damage in X-irradiated LY-S than LY-R cells.
